Planning appeal decision

Notice varied and upheld27 September 20213265387

Land and premises at 62 Legon Avenue, Rush Green, Romford, RM7 0UJ

without planning permission, the unauthorised change of use of the property to a Car Hire Company (Sui Generis)

Authority
London Borough of Barking and Dagenham Council
Appeal type
enforcement · Enforcement Notice
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
other · Change of use
Inspector
Satheesan R

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• Whether the steps required by the enforcement notice exceed what is necessary to remedy the breach of planning control
  • Whether the period specified in the notice for compliance is reasonable

What decided it

The absence of any alterations or fixtures at the property meant that step 2 of the enforcement notice was excessive and went beyond what was necessary to remedy the breach of planning control.
